The best couples shower themes are the ones that feel like the couple. The Perfect Pear theme works beautifully because it is clever without being costume-y, it translates into every detail of the event effortlessly, and it has a natural color palette of soft greens, whites, and warm neutrals that feels fresh and sophisticated for both a spring bridal shower and a summer wedding shower. It also photographs absolutely beautifully which matters more than people realize.








The table is the centerpiece of any couples shower and this one delivered on every level. Think lush florals in soft whites and greens that nod to the pear theme without being literal about it. Layered linens, intentional place settings, and floral arrangements that feel abundant and garden-fresh. The goal is a table that looks effortless but was clearly thought through from every angle. For a spring bridal shower or summer bridal shower this kind of organic, floral forward table setting is exactly what guests want to see and what photographs beautifully for the couple to look back on.








The details are what made this shower feel completely curated from start to finish. The signature cocktail was a Hugo Spritz — light, effervescent, and with an Italian coastal quality that tied the whole aesthetic together perfectly. Made with prosecco, elderflower liqueur, fresh mint, and a splash of soda water it is the kind of drink that feels special without being complicated and looks absolutely stunning in photos. The party favors carried that same intentional energy with custom matchbooks and small bottles of olive oil that leaned into the Italian theme and felt elevated rather than generic. These are the kinds of unique bridal shower favors that guests actually keep and use rather than leaving behind on the table.











If you have not considered a couples shower instead of a traditional bridal shower it is worth thinking about. A couples shower invites both partners to celebrate together with their people rather than splitting the pre-wedding celebrations across two separate events. It tends to feel more relaxed, more inclusive, and honestly more fun because everyone is in the same room. For a theme like The Perfect Pear which is warm and celebratory and a little playful a couples shower is the perfect format.
